The program is available on all versions of Windows starting with Windows 7. If you press the keyboard shortcut, the screen is turned into a drawing board that you can draw a rectangle on. This works similarly to how third-party screen capture programs such as SnagIt or Greenshot handle this type of screen capture. If you want to capture a video of your screen—perhaps to show how an app works—use the Xbox app’s Game Recorder in Windows 10. The Xbox app is designed to record videos of games but can also take videos of most apps in Windows—though not your full desktop.
